I would like to go a river cruise but dont want to go on escorted excursions every day in various cities we pass through. I dont mind getting off the ship and wandering about myself. These holidays usually add in the cost of the excursions so I dislike the though of paying for a service I dont want. Are there any companies that do cruises without excursions?

river cruises mostly include the excursions, at least local ones, mainly because everyone else does. They're usually just walks (as the ships moor in the middle of town) so the actual cost of them wouldn't be high; no need to hire coaches.
Mr S and I have just come back from a river cruise, on the Rhine,
Fifth time we have been, a lot of the excursions are extra, but even the ones that are free are not compulsory,
You can leave the ship and do your own thing,
just check what time the ship leaves, and where it is going to be berthed next before you go off on your own.
